This image is what I found on google, I think this is a perfect example of how the ISO is set on a camera, and what differences it can make when taking pictures. It shows, when you're taking a picture, and have the camera set to manual, you are the person to allow a certain amount of light in through the lens.

This is a diagram how how the ISO, Aperture and Shutter Speed all works when taking an image on the camera. Its like a chart, and they all work together to get the final outcome of the actual image.
